I'm shaving my head to raise money for childhood cancer research! I know I don't have much hair anyways so no big deal BUT it is a big deal for my wife, Mariah and her beautiful hair so I'm happy to support her and her team AND because I often reflect how fortunate I feel that my children were blessed with good health!! So many are NOT so fortunate! Our team goal is to raise $20,000 !! Our motto is to go big or go home...although EITHER WAY we WON'T BE GOING HOME WITH ANY HAIR LOL!! SO PLEASE DONATE!! A big goal divided between many is no longer so big! Did you know that kids' cancers are different from adult cancers? It's true. And childhood cancer research is extremely underfunded. I can't do this alone my peeps !! Every dollar makes a difference for the thousands of infants, children, teens, and young adults fighting childhood cancers! So Donate and then come see me get my head shaved March 12th at Paddy's!! :D
